Transaction 331229b73e26bde78c240367a335fdf83c2f54303775f92b14020b701486dbb2
1 Input
2 Outputs
- 331229b73e26bde78c240367a335fdf83c2f54303775f92b14020b701486dbb2:0
- 331229b73e26bde78c240367a335fdf83c2f54303775f92b14020b701486dbb2:1
value 186000000
address 16ZuHHE3rg254497uwRaXvWSxn9ixRpTrj
value 39647227
address 15HZQm8GZzMY1D7ENKT89rEhfSjQJS3EH8